Kaiser is a WWI-themed video online slot from Peter & Sons set on a 5x5 grid with 40 paylines. The year is 1914, and the game puts you alongside Hans Schultz, a lone soldier scoring wins behind enemy lines for his Kaiser.
The base game randomly places 3 to 10 Wilds on the board with a multiplier that climbs each time the feature fires. Three Scatters trigger 7 free spins with roaming Wilds and a multiplier that reaches 5x without ever resetting. The max win is 2,000x the bet, and RTP reaches up to 96%.

Peter & Sons set Kaiser in 1914 at the opening of the First World War. The reels are populated with WWI imagery: eagle emblems, Iron Crosses, artillery, and the soldier Hans Schultz himself as the Wild symbol.
The tone is bold and stylised rather than realistic. Multiplier Wilds and roaming mechanics give the game a progressive momentum that fits the military advance theme without taking it too seriously.

Kaiser operates on a dynamic RTP model ranging from 86% to 96%. The highest configuration sits at 96%, which is competitive across the broader slots market. Volatility is mid-high, meaning wins are not frequent but meaningful when the Wild multiplier fires or free spins land.
Hit frequency sits at approximately 20%, so roughly one in five spins produces a return in the base game.
Kaiser accepts bets from $0.20 to $100 per spin. The range covers low-stakes sessions and moderate high-roller play, though the $100 ceiling is narrower than some comparable titles.
The simulated maximum win is 2,000x the bet. That figure is achievable within 1 billion simulated rounds and reflects the combined output of the Wild multiplier feature and the free spins multiplier climbing to 5x across multiple roaming Wilds.
Kaiser uses 40 fixed paylines across a 5x5 grid, evaluated left to right. Only the highest win per line is paid.
Wilds substitute for all symbols except the Scatter. At random intervals during the main game, the Wild placement feature fires and places 3 to 10 Wilds randomly across the board. Each time it triggers, the Wild multiplier increases by one step up to a maximum of 3x, then resets and begins climbing again.
Three Scatter symbols landing on reels 2, 3, and 4 trigger the bonus round, awarding 7 free spins.
At the start of free spins, 3 to 10 roaming Wilds are placed on the board. On every spin these Wilds move to new random positions. Collecting additional Scatters during the feature increases the Wild multiplier in steps from 1x up to 5x. The multiplier does not reset during the feature. Each multiplier upgrade also awards 2 extra spins.
The combination of up to 10 roaming Wilds at a 5x multiplier across extra spins is where the 2,000x ceiling comes from.

Kaiser runs on Peter & Sons' HTML5 engine and is optimised for iOS and Android browsers. The 5x5 grid scales cleanly in portrait mode. No app download is required on Gamdom. All features, including the roaming Wild animations and multiplier display, render correctly at mobile viewport widths.

Kaiser delivers a clear mechanic loop: random Wild placement builds a multiplier in the base game, and free spins extend that logic with roaming Wilds that compound rather than reset. The 2,000x ceiling is modest compared to extreme-volatility titles, but the mid-high volatility profile and 20% hit frequency make sessions more active than most bonus-dependent releases.
The dynamic RTP model means verifying the active configuration before playing is worthwhile. At the 96% configuration Kaiser is a competitive choice for players who want a WWI aesthetic with a well-structured Wild multiplier engine.
